Day 1

Arusha to Tarangire National Park

Arusha to Tarangire National Park

We will pick you up from your hotel at 8:30 am, we will drive to Tarangire National Park (2 hours drive) famous for its diverse landscape. The park is particularly known for the abundance of ancient baobab trees and having the largest concentration of elephants in the whole country. It provides unique chances to observe the interactions between elephant families. We will do a game drive through the park depending on where they are reported sightings of animals (mostly predators, lions, cheetah and leopards as they are harder to spot)

Later on, we will go to the Tarangire River picnic site and enjoy the beautiful view of the river and animals while having lunch. Small monkeys and baboons will try to scare you off your lunch but there is nothing to worry about.
After lunch, proceed with the game drive to the evening before camping in Tarangire in a few crowds camp unlike central Serengeti camps its a pure wild camping experience.

Day 2

Mto Wa Mbu

Mto Wa Mbu

In the morning, we’ll set out on a cultural cycling tour around Mto wa Mbu, riding through small villages where you’ll see banana farms, rice plantations, and meet members of the local community. During lunchtime, you’ll enjoy a traditional local meal prepared in the village.

The route also takes us through nearby forests and past beautiful waterfalls before we return to the lodge in the evening.

Day 3

Serengeti National Park

Serengeti National Park

After breakfast you will depart from Mto wa Mbu and drive to Serengeti National Park. The journey takes approximately six hours, including scenic stops, as you pass through the beautiful Ngorongoro Conservation Area.

Along the way, there is an optional visit to a traditional Maasai village (not included in the tour price). This cultural experience offers insight into the heritage and customs of the Maasai community. While some historic practices are no longer observed, visitors can still learn about their traditions, lifestyle, and unique customs.
Entrance fee: USD 10–20 per person
Please note that many travelers choose to skip this optional activity.

You will arrive in the late afternoon and continue with a game drive in the Seronera area (central Serengeti) until early evening. Enjoy the stunning Serengeti sunset while observing wildlife in their natural habitat. With a bit of luck you may witness predators on the move or even a hunt. Day 4

Central Serengeti National Park

Central Serengeti National Park

After an early breakfast at 6:30 a.m., you will set out for a sunrise game drive in Serengeti National Park, one of the best times to spot active wildlife. You’ll continue exploring the plains until early afternoon, when you’ll return to camp for lunch and to pack up.

Later, you’ll enjoy another game drive as you exit the Serengeti and travel toward Simba Campsite, located near the rim of the Ngorongoro Crater (approximately a two-hour drive). Keep your camera ready, as wildlife is often seen even around the campsite.

Day 5

Ngorongoro Crater

Ngorongoro Crater

After an early breakfast, you will descend into the crater at 6:15 a.m. for a morning game drive, with a special focus on spotting the rare black rhino. Rhinos are among the most difficult animals to see here, while many other species are easier to locate due to the crater’s open floor and natural enclosure.

After lunch, you will continue with a short game drive before ascending from the crater floor at around 12:45 p.m. You will then return to camp to pack up before beginning your journey back to Arusha.
